Directions:

  1. Heat the oil in a small pan and cook the onion, garlic and paste stirring until the onion is soft.
  2. Using your hands (that are clean) combine the onion mixture, lamb, half the parsley, egg and breadcrumbs in a large bowl; mix well.
  3. Shape 1/4 cups of mixture into sausages.
  4. Cover and refrigerate until firm.
  5. (Can leave overnight or freeze at this stage) Cook the sausages in a large oiled pan in batches, until browned all over and cooked through.
  6. Meanwhile boil, steam, or microwave the potato and pumpkin separately until soft and tender.
  7. Drain.
  8. Mash the potato and pumpkin with the milk and cheese.
  9. Serve with the sausages, sprinkled with remaining parsley.
